There are so many incredible Bali tours that you'd need to spend a month on the island to just scratch the surface. Yet if you're only here for a short time, there are certain experiences that you shouldn't miss.
Surrounded by tropical forests, rice terraces and ancient temples, Ubud is a paradise for adventurous travelers. The town is perfectly positioned for day trips too, although there's plenty to see and do in Ubud itself.
Located on the outskirts of town, the Ubud Monkey Forest is one of the most famous attractions. This mysterious forest is a sanctuary for long-tailed macaques, and you'll see them scampering around the temples and trees. They're partial to an easy meal so keep your food well hidden!
The Tegenungan Waterfall is another highlight. Just a short hop from Ubud, this picturesque cascade is hidden deep in the jungle – it's a great place for a swim. A further popular stop on Ubud day tours is a coffee plantation to try some of the famous Kopi Luwak coffee.
Bali was just made for Instagram. Even if you're not a social media devotee, you can't help but be drawn to the photogenic landscapes of this alluring island. There are many key locations across Bali that offer those iconic snaps that everyone raves about.
To make it easy for you to find these famous spots, there are Bali tours that specialize in getting you to those Instagrammable destinations. It's best to book early as they're super popular!
First up on your agenda is Lempuyang's Gate of Heaven. You'll probably have seen pictures of this on Instagram, but it's even better in real life with incredible views of Mount Agung. Meanwhile, at the Tirta Gangga Temple, you can take selfies by the royal water palace and see the traditional bathing pools.
Another popular stop is the Jungle Swing. Soak up the rainforest panoramas as you soar through the air while your companions take those all-important photographs. There are several swings dotted around the Ubud area, so you can take your pick.
Tanah Lot is a must-see for anyone who visits Bali. It's probably the most popular temple on the island and makes for great photos. This 16th-century Hindu complex is dedicated to the Sea Gods and is fittingly located on an offshore island surrounded by the ocean.
Featured on many Bali tours, the Tanah Lot Temple is over in the east of the island, in Beraban village. Tanah Lot is a UNESCO World Heritage site and is visited by millions of people each year. It's renowned for its sunsets so be sure to visit in the evening – arrive early to bag your spot.
At low tide you can cross to the rock and see the base close up. If you miss that experience, don't worry, there's still plenty to see on the mainland. You can wander around the onshore temple, learning about the history of the site.
This is also a great place to buy souvenirs. There's a local market with stalls selling artisan crafts, handmade textiles and even Balinese instruments.
Bali is phenomenal from the ground but imagine what it looks like from above! By taking a hiking tour up Mount Batur you'll find out! This active volcano offers some of the best views on the island – you'll be safe in the hands of your local expert guide.
The ultimate time to summit Mount Batur is at sunrise when the island is flooded with color. This means you'll have an early start – often at 1 AM – but you'll agree it's worth it when you reach the top. You'll be picked up at your hotel, so you don't need to worry about transport.
The hike up is steep, but the challenge makes the experience even more rewarding. Your aim is to summit before dawn, ready to bask in the golden sunrise. Enjoy a few moments soaking up your achievement before heading down.
Sunrises aside, Mount Batur has a lot more to offer. You can hike to hidden waterfalls, take a dip in the hot springs and visit local villages down in the valleys.
The Blue Lagoon is another favorite destination on many Bali tours. This is one of the best places on the island to go snorkeling, thanks to the crystal-clear waters and abundant marine life.
You'll find the Blue Lagoon in Padang Bai village on the southeastern coast of Bali. You can enjoy a day trip to the Blue Lagoon from many towns and resorts across the island, including Kuta, Jimbaran and Seminyak.
This idyllic bay is famed for its diverse wildlife, with shoals of colorful fish and vibrant coral reefs to discover. Most people come here on Bali snorkeling tours, and it's the perfect place for beginners to give it a go. Blue Lagoon scuba diving excursions are also available for those who want to go a bit deeper.
When you want a break from snorkeling, take to the sandy beach and enjoy a bit of sunbathing. Quad biking adventures and waterfall hikes are also on the cards in the beautiful Blue Lagoon region.
The laid-back seaside town of Lovina is a great alternative to the lively southern coast. Lovina Beach is home to several charming villages where tourists are welcomed by friendly locals. You'll find this peaceful haven on Bali's north coast – visit on a day tour or stay a few nights.
Lovina is known for being one of the top places for Bali dolphin watching tours. You'll head out by boat in the early morning, keeping watch for the bottlenose dolphins that frequent these waters. Take in the sunrise while enjoying close encounters with these wild marine creatures.
If you're on a Lovina day tour, you'll also visit the Ulun Danu Beratan Temple. This iconic complex is prettily situated beside Lake Beratan. The experience is both cultural and spiritual – Ulun Danu ranks among Bali's' most sacred sites.
If you want to linger for longer in Lovina, there are plenty of jungle adventures and waterfalls near to the town. It's a great place for nature lovers!
For a change of scenery, why not take a day trip to Nusa Penida? This island is part of an archipelago just off Bali's southeast coast that also includes Nusa Lembongan and Nusa Ceningan. It's a stunning spot, with dramatic cliffs, colorful wildflowers and 360-degree sea views.
Nusa Penida is popular with Instagrammers looking for that perfect shot. It's easy to see why with the turquoise water and white limestone cliffs putting on a beautiful display. The island interior is rugged, so the best way to explore is on a guided excursion with a local expert.
These Bali tours often feature Broken Beach and Angel's Billabong, where crashing waves add to the scenic effect. Admire the views from the clifftop and take photos of the mesmerizing natural infinity pool. You'll also visit the white sands of Kelingking Beach and look for manta rays in Crytal Bay.
You'll access Nusa Penida on one of the Bali boat tours that service these islands. For a fast ride, opt for a speedboat transfer so that you have longer to explore.
Get the adrenaline pumping with a white water expedition down one of Bali's rivers. This is a great way to see a different side of the island and immerse yourself in nature. There are several courses of varying difficulty, so there's something for beginners and experts alike.
The Ayung River is easily accessible from Ubud – it's just 15 minutes from town. The rapids are Class II and III, which is perfect for families and novices. The 2-hour route takes you through rainforests and paddy fields, as well as passing a waterfall and rock carvings.
Looking for something a bit more technical? Rafting on the Telaga Waja River is an exhilarating 3-hour experience, with 17 kilometers of Class III and IV rapids to navigate. Your professional river guide will put you through your paces as you plunge through the frothing water.
Up the action even further with a trip down the Melangit River. Here, you'll be faced with Class IV rapids and plenty of steep drops thrown in for added thrills.
Sunsets often feature on Bali tours, but the one at Uluwatu Temple is the cream of the crop. Uluwatu is known as the island's holiest temple and sits majestically on a clifftop on the southern tip of Bali.
Uluwatu is a relatively small temple, but its dramatic position makes it a captivating prospect for visitors. Stroll along the cliff edge and soak up those views while learning about the history of the complex from your guide.
As well as enjoying the sublime sunset over the Indian Ocean, you can take in a bit of culture while you're there. Each evening, the traditional Kecak dance is performed in the temple amphitheater, against a stunning ocean backdrop. It's an energetic and colorful spectacle, with fire dances and storytelling adding to the magic.
Some excursions include a delicious seafood supper on Jimbaran Beach. This is the perfect place to escape the crowds of the south, and there's some great surfing to be had here too.
Rustle up a feast at one of the many cooking classes in Bali. If you've enjoyed the local cuisine during your vacation, why not learn how to cook some of it? No experience is necessary as you'll be given expert tuition throughout your course.
Whether you book a group lesson or prefer a one-to-one session, you'll come away with lots of new skills. Some workshops take place on organic farms while others are hosted in local homes. It doesn't get more authentic than cooking with a multigenerational family.
You'll often get to visit the market before your class to source fresh ingredients. Your guide will teach you about local produce and introduce the recipes you'll be tackling in the kitchen. For something special, head to Sideman and learn how to cook with fire rather than gas or electricity. You can always opt for a food tour for a true Balinese food-tasting experience.
The best bit, of course, is getting to eat the results of your culinary creations after the lesson. Take the recipes home so you can recreate them after your trip.
The dreamy island of Bali is one of the most visited destinations in Indonesia, and perhaps even the world. Sitting between Java and Lombok, it's ideally placed for a bit of island hopping, although there's plenty to see and do in Bali itself. Most people come for a week or two so they can take in all the top sights.
Thanks to its global popularity, Bali is well connected to the rest of the world, with frequent flights making it easy to reach. Millions of people come here each year to enjoy the relaxed Balinese lifestyle, with temples, beaches and forests never far away.
Bali is a volcanic island, with eruptions occurring as recently as the 20th century. There are three active volcanoes on Bali, some of which you can hike up for sweeping views. The landscapes of this lush island have been shaped by volcanic activity, with fertile soils creating a lush tropical kingdom.
Known as the "Land of the Gods", Bali is a heavenly destination. Much of the interior is carpeted in rice paddy fields, punctuated with palm trees and jaw-dropping scenery. It's a rural island, yet in the coastal resorts, you'll find modern life in abundance, including some of the world's top hotels.
Bali is warm all year round, so the main thing to consider when booking your trip is the rain. The dry season runs between April and September, and this is when most people visit. Yet the wet season, which runs from October to March, makes the island lush and beautiful to photograph.
One of the most popular ways of traveling around Bali is by moped. They're cheap and easy to drive along the rural roads, but make sure you have the correct license and always wear a helmet. Taxis are available for local journeys, and you can hire a car and driver for longer trips if you prefer not to take the wheel.
For a cultural experience in the heart of nature, consider staying in the Ubud region. Here, you'll find swathes of rice terraces, lush jungles and traditional restaurants. Accommodation ranges from cheap and cheerful to uber-luxurious – there's something for everyone.
If you prefer more of a beach vibe, head to the coastal resorts of Seminyak, Canggu and Kuta. You'll have all the facilities you need here, as well as a vibrant ex-pat scene and buzzing nightlife. If you can, split your time between Ubud and the coast for a rounded experience.
If you're not tired of temples after visiting Lempuyang's Gate of Heaven, Tirta Gangga and Tanah Lot, then there are several more to see. The Besakih Temple is the largest Hindu complex in Bali, while at the Tirta Empul Temple, you'll see natural springs and bathing rituals.
To explore some of the more rugged parts of the island, Bali Volkswagen tours are the way to go. You'll arrive at your destinations in style and enjoy some enviable photo opportunities. Eat Pray Love tours are also available and are particular favorites amongst travelers who have read the famous book.
Other places not to miss on Bali tours are the vast Jatiluwih Rice Terraces and the mountain lake resort of Bedugul. For something different, take a day trip to Lombok from Bali, or explore the pristine beaches of the remote Gili Islands.
If you're keeping an eye on your budget, there are plenty of free things to do in Bali. There's no charge to witness many of the island's religious ceremonies, which are often very moving experiences. You can hike the Campuhan Ridge in Ubud for some great views or visit the turtle conservation center at Kuta Beach for your nature fix.